    Gisèle Halimi

    Tunisian-French lawyer and politician (1927–2020)

    Gisèle Halimi (born Zeiza Gisèle Élise Taïeb; 27 July 1927 – 28 July 2020) was a Tunisian-French lawyer, politician, essayist and feminist activist.[1]

    Biography

    Zeiza Gisèle Élise Taïeb was born in La Goulette, Tunisia, on 27 July 1927 to a practicing Jewish Berber family.

    Her father, Edouard Taïeb, began as a courier in a law office before becoming a notary clerk and then a legal expert.
